Position Summary:

The Food and Beverage Supervisor is responsible for overseeing the restaurant and restaurant team. Provide all guests with courteous, professional, and efficient service that supports the restaurant’s operating procedures, brand promise and standards.

Essential functions:

Ensure all food and beverage team members deliver the brand and provide exceptional service. Assist and support food and beverage team members. Inspect the food and beverage outlets daily for cleanliness and sanitation. Have a thorough knowledge of menus and applicable specials. Lead and manage the restaurant, room service and bar areas to ensure brand standards are adhered to. Remain in dining room during peak business hours, greet and engage with guests to ensure an enjoyable dining experience. Address guest and team member concerns, reacting quickly and professionally. Assist Assistant Director of Food and Beverage with talent acquisition. Assist with departmental training and schedule team members for training. Be able to operate the hotel computer system. Supervise the F&B team to perform opening and closing procedures with service staff. Follow the proper procedure regarding cash handling, following cash bank reconciliation and end of shift drop. Spot check guest checks to ensure proper check handling. Ensure supplies are stocked, submit requests for purchasing items in a timely fashion. Maintain a clean and efficient restaurant. Know and comply with state food handling and liquor laws. Adhere to hotel grooming and uniform standards. Perform any additional tasks requested by management.
